15. Dez 2002, 15:49
Moin Nailor,
falls ich Dich richtig verstanden habe:
Erstelle eine Datei mit dem Namen MyFont.rc, z.B. mit Notepad.
Da hinein kommt die Zeile
MY_FONT SMILLY "SMILLY.TTF"
MY_FONT ist der Name der Resource die geladen werden soll,
SMILLY ist der (selbstdefinierte) Resourcentyp und
"SMILLY.TTF" ist der Name der Fontdatei.
Wird der Name ohne Pfad angegeben, so muss sich die Datei im gleichen Verzeichnis befinden, wie die .RC Datei.
Dateien vom Typ .RC sind, sozusagen, Resourcen Sourcecode Dateien.
Du kannst jetzt versuchen, statt
{$R MyFont.res}
mal
{$R MyFont.RC}
anzugeben, damit die Resourcen direkt eincompiliert werden (was allerdings nicht immer funktioniert), oder mit Hilfe des Borland Resourcencompilers BRCC32.EXE (zu finden im Delphi\Bin Verzeichnis) aus der RC Datei eine RES Datei erzeugen.
Wichtig: BRCC32 ist ein Kommandozeilen Programm.
Wird kein Ausgabedateiname angegeben, so bekommt die Compilierte Resourcendatei (RES) den Namen der Sourcedatei (RC).
War's das, was Du noch wissen wolltest?
Tschüss Chris
Die drei Feinde des Programmierers: Sonne, Frischluft und dieses unerträgliche Gebrüll der Vögel.
Der Klügere gibt solange nach bis er der Dumme ist
|